Transaction 942991f71efda01c78c1e937dc68b81fbea4c2bae2cbb62b61538f15bde1164d

2 Input
2 Outputs
  • 942991f71efda01c78c1e937dc68b81fbea4c2bae2cbb62b61538f15bde1164d:0
  • value  45421612
    address  1BPBUT2pyPHp3Y3gEoNv7T9KbY2KNb8Hzo
  • 942991f71efda01c78c1e937dc68b81fbea4c2bae2cbb62b61538f15bde1164d:1
  • value  1010006
    address  1CmE1mtesabZbuNc7SwhrsWUboyrXS9c7V